The Friends of the Aiken County Historical Museum are pleased to offer a three-lecture series of talks about Aiken County's history. This summer series will be held at the Woodside Country Club. Dinner will be served at 6 pm and the lectures will begin at 6:30 pm. There will be a cash bar available.

Lecture # 1:

The first lecture will be held on Tuesday, June 10. The topic is "South Carolina Alcohol and Saloons" with speaker J.R. Fennell, director of the Lexington County Museum. This presentation will examine the history of alcohol in South Carolina and Aiken County from the beginning of European settlement to the end of prohibition in the 20th century. Attendees will learn about efforts to pass laws controlling alcohol in the antebellum period as well as those who broke the law and made and sold illegal liquor during prohitibion. The presentation will also mention the Dispensary system, which saw the state of South Carolina have a monopoly on alcohol sales.

Lecture # 2:

The second lecture will be held on Tuesday, July 8. The topic is "Women of the Winter Colony" by speaker Linda Johnson, president of the Historic Aiken Foundation. This presentation will show that the women of the Winter Colony didn't just ride horses and host dinners. These accomplished women were movers and shakers who established many of the institutions Aiken enjoys today. Come learn about them!

Lecture # 3:

The third and final lecture will be held on Tuesday, August 12. The topic is "Shady Characters of the Winter Colony" by speaker Lauren Virgo, director of the Aiken County Historical Museum. This lecture will feature several hilarious, scandalous, and murderous tales to be told about the residents of Aiken's Winter Colony. From the mysterious stabbing of a Winter Colony playboy to the coward of the Titanic who stayed at the Willcox and to the Winter Colonist who lost half of his face because of a fake medicine, this lecture will explore several shady stories and characters from Aiken's past.
